There's more than one way to relax when you're not singing to a live audience night after night.

Spamalot actor Nik Walker, who's currently starring as Sir Galahad in the Monty Python musical eight times a week on Broadway, says when he's between projects he loves to relax at a good old American theme park — and he even brings his bestie with him.

"Taran Killam, who plays Lancelot in the show, he's my theme park brother," Walker, 34, says. "We did the Star Wars: Galactic Starcruiser hotel together before it closed. It was a spectacular experience. And we're going to Epic Universe when it opens [in 2025]," he says of Universal Orlando's planned fourth park. "We're very excited to do that one!"

Related: Taran Killam: Five Things to Know

Walker says that he's such a park diehard that he's quietly become the go-to vacation planner for his Broadway pals.

"Literally there was a moment when I was just planning theme park vacations for all the Broadway people," he says with a laugh. "I wasn't taking any money for it. I just loved it so much."

He even got his wife Sarah Joyce in on the action.

"When I first brought my wife to Universal Studios when we were first dating, and she is a very sophisticated person, she was like, 'Why are we going to this place that's built for children?' Now she'll just go straight to Diagon Alley by herself, beg me for five more minutes."

Walker says his love of parks may stems from all the serious roles he's played on Broadway. 'I've made my career playing dark, brooding people," says Walker, who will next star alongside Matt Damon in the upcoming movie The Instigators.

"I go to Disney World and Universal Studios maybe three times a year. I have a trunk of Nerf guns in my dressing room, I'm literally staring at a Darth Star poster right now. So the the idea that I'm a grown child who can somehow pay his bills has been with me for a long time," he says.

He adds that's why he loves being in such a fun, upbeat show like Spamalot. "Doing this, where I can just kind of show up to play, is so freeing. The stakes are off in a way because it's just like, yeah, just go up there and literally be a kid!"
